State Bank of India (SBI) has released Advertisement No. CRPD/SCO/2026-27/23 for the engagement of Specialist Cadre Officers on Contract Basis, specifically for its Wealth Management vertical. A total of 207 vacancies have been notified across seven senior and mid-level roles — from Zonal Head down to Investment Officer — with annual CTC ranging up to ₹97 lakh for the most senior post. This is one of SBI’s most lucrative specialist hiring drives, aimed at experienced professionals from banking, wealth management, and asset management backgrounds. These five posts alone account for 201 vacancies; the remaining 6 vacancies are split between Zonal Head (Retail) and Regional Head (RH) posts, which also carry a small number of backlog vacancies reserved for SC/ST/OBC/EWS/PwBD categories.

Important rules on Circle selection: For the five circle-based posts, candidates must indicate three different Circle preferences while applying. Repeating a Circle by mistake, or any incorrect selection, is resolved entirely at the Bank’s discretion — this decision is final, and no request for change of Circle preference is entertained at any stage. If you don’t get any of your chosen Circles, your candidature may still be considered for other Circles.

Note: Vacancies mentioned are indicative, and the Bank reserves the right to transfer selected officers to any SBI office in India, or depute them to any associate/subsidiary organisation, based on service requirements. Requests for a specific posting location will not be entertained.

4. Eligibility Criteria

A. Zonal Head (Retail)

  • Qualification: Graduate from a Government-recognised university. Preferred: MBA (Banking/Finance/Marketing) with 60% marks, or certifications like CFP/CFA/NISM V-A/NISM Investment Advisor/NISM 21-A.
  • Experience: Minimum 15 years managing sales in Wealth Management/Retail Banking/AMCs, of which at least 5 years leading a large team of Relationship Managers/Team Leads, preferably in a Wealth Management firm or AMC.

B. Regional Head (RH)

  • Qualification: Same as Zonal Head.
  • Experience: Minimum 12+ years in relationship management, preferably in wealth management with leading Public/Private/Foreign Banks, Wealth Management firms, or AMCs, including 5+ years leading a large team.

C. Relationship Manager – Team Lead

  • Qualification: Same as above.
  • Experience: Minimum 8 years in relationship management, preferably in wealth management with leading Banks/Broking/Security firms/AMCs. Experience as a Team Lead is preferred.

D. Investment Specialist (IS)

  • Qualification: A PG Degree/PG Diploma in Finance, Accountancy, Business Management, Commerce, Economics, Capital Markets, Banking, Insurance, or Actuarial Science, or CA/CFA.
  • Experience: Minimum 6 years post-qualification experience as an investment advisor/counsellor/officer or part of a product team in Wealth Management firms/AMCs.

E. Investment Officer (IO)

  • Qualification: Same as Investment Specialist.
  • Experience: Minimum 4 years post-qualification experience in a similar investment advisory role.

F. VP Wealth (SRM)

  • Qualification: Graduate from a Government-recognised university. Preferred: NISM V-A/XXI-A, CFP/CFA certifications.
  • Experience: Minimum 6 years in sales & marketing with leading Banks/Wealth Management firms/AMCs (essential), plus preferably 6 years as a Relationship Manager in Wealth Management.

G. AVP Wealth (RM)

  • Qualification: Same as VP Wealth.
  • Experience: Minimum 3 years in sales & marketing with leading Banks/Wealth Management firms/AMCs, or SBI Wealth CREs with 4 years of experience.

Common notes across all posts:

  • Teaching and training experience will not be counted toward eligibility.
  • Experience of less than 6 months in any organisation is not considered.
  • Work experience is verified through experience certificates, appraisal letters, appointment/relieving letters, or offer letters combined with IT returns.
  • Candidates from SBI Group companies must submit a No Objection Certificate (NOC) from their employer at the time of applying.
  • Candidates can apply for more than one post, provided they meet the eligibility criteria for each.

5. Selection Process

  1. Shortlisting: Meeting the minimum qualification and experience does not automatically entitle a candidate to an interview call. A shortlisting committee decides the parameters, and only the number of candidates the Bank decides will be called.
  2. Interview: One or more rounds of personal, telephonic, or video interview, carrying 100 marks. Qualifying marks are decided by the Bank.
  3. CTC Negotiation: Conducted individually with each candidate, either during or after the interview process.
  4. Merit List: Prepared in descending order of interview marks only. If candidates tie at the cut-off, the older candidate (by age) is ranked higher.

Shortlisting is provisional, without verification of original documents — final candidature is subject to document verification at the time of the interview.

6. Salary & Remuneration (CTC Structure)

This role offers a genuinely high compensation structure compared to typical SBI recruitment:

PostAnnual CTC (Upper Range)
Zonal Head (Retail)₹97.00 lakh
Regional Head (RH)₹66.40 lakh
Relationship Manager – Team Lead₹51.80 lakh
VP Wealth (SRM)₹44.70 lakh
Investment Specialist (IS)₹44.50 lakh
AVP Wealth (RM)₹30.20 lakh
Investment Officer (IO)₹27.10 lakh

CTC Bifurcation (example — Zonal Head):

  • Fixed Pay: ₹66.00 lakh
  • Conveyance, Mobile & Medical Allowances: ₹1.10 lakh
  • Performance Linked Pay: 0% to 45% of Fixed Pay
  • Annual Increment Band: 0% to 25%

Similar fixed-pay-plus-variable structures apply to all seven posts, with Fixed Pay ranging from ₹18 lakh (Investment Officer) up to ₹66 lakh (Zonal Head), plus Performance Linked Pay of up to 45% of fixed pay based on performance rating.

Important: Annual CTC is negotiable, and depends on the candidate’s experience, current emoluments, and place of posting.

Contract Terms

  • Contract Period: 5 years, renewable for another 4 years at the Bank’s discretion, subject to conditions.
  • Termination: Either side can terminate with 2 months’ notice, or by payment/surrender of 2 months’ compensation in lieu.
  • Leave: 30 days of leave per financial year, granted for genuine and appropriate reasons.

9. Other Important Conditions

  • Candidates previously issued an offer letter for Wealth Management/Premier Banking roles who did not join are debarred for 2 years from the date of non-joining.
  • Candidates who were previously engaged on contract for these posts and subsequently resigned are debarred for 2 years from the date of resignation.
  • Candidates against whom a caution notice was issued after resignation are barred from all future SBI recruitment.
  • Candidates with pending criminal cases must disclose this at the interview stage; the Bank may independently verify this, including through police records.
  • Outstation candidates called for interview are reimbursed travel fare for the shortest route (as specified in the call letter) — local conveyance (taxi/cab/personal vehicle) is not reimbursed.
  • Any legal disputes related to this recruitment fall under the exclusive jurisdiction of Mumbai courts.
